What is Sheet Stretch Forming Machine?

Sheet stretch forming is a manufacturing process used to shape sheet metal into complex curved parts, often for aerospace applications. Here’s how it works:

  1. Clamping: A sheet of metal is securely clamped along its edges.
  2. Tension: Hydraulic rams pull on the clamps, stretching the sheet of metal beyond its yield point (where it would normally deform permanently).
  3. Forming: While stretched, the metal is lowered and pressed over a specially shaped die or form block. The combination of tension and pressing forces the metal to take the shape of the die.

Sheet Stretch Forming Machines Specialized presses are used to perform the stretch forming process.

Sheet Stretch Forming Machine

Key features

  • Powerful Rams: High tonnage hydraulic rams provide the immense stretching force.
  • Die Table: A table to securely mount the form blocks/dies.
  • Jaws: Clamping jaws that grip the sheet metal edges.
  • Computer Controls: Modern machines use CNC (Computer Numerical Control) for precision.

Benefits of Sheet Stretch Forming

  • Complex Shapes: Stretch forming can create parts with compound curves not easily achievable with other methods.
  • Large Parts: Ideal for large aerospace components like wing skins and fuselage panels.
  • Strength: The stretching process can increase the strength of the formed part.
  • Minimal Springback: The process helps minimize the tendency of the metal to return to its original shape after forming.
